Taught My Kid to Rap

Taught my kid to wrap 
Her brain
Around the insane
To inject herself
Into what remains
From desolation and pain

Told her life’s anything but plain
To see the sun within the rain
From black and white to seek the gray
Better still, a rainbow shines her way
To see the magic in the everyday
Turn work into play
To see the world as her stage
To stay young at any age

Truth be told, she taught me the same
